Output 40143ff11e9c5666bdf28b5bc8e1db38921d80ffca94ce27ee985bc420fd6013:0

value
2397877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e3bb6b66190f0708c8c64639fb22323863f51b9 OP_EQUAL
address
3Ef5QmN5ma6THQyZziWLLEUdsFmLQmkmP6
transaction
40143ff11e9c5666bdf28b5bc8e1db38921d80ffca94ce27ee985bc420fd6013
confirmations
280747
spent
true